Table Structures and Column Definitions
Each sheet features structured tables with the following column types:
Budget Allocation by Workflow Table (Main Table)
- Workflow ID: Unique identifier (e.g., WF-001, WF-002).
- Workflow Name: Human-readable name of the process.
- Department: Assigns workflow to a functional unit.
- Budget Category: e.g., Labor, Supplies, Technology, Training.
- Planned Budget (USD): Initial financial allocation (data type: numeric).
- Forecasted Cost (USD): Estimated cost based on workflow efficiency trends.
- Process Duration (days): Average time from start to completion.
- Efficiency Score (%): Calculated as (planned throughput / actual throughput) × 100.
- Status: Open, In Progress, Completed, or Revised.
Actual vs. Budget Performance Table
- Date Range: Start and end dates of the workflow cycle.
- Actual Process Time (days): Measured time in real operations.
- Actual Cost (USD): Real expenditures reported from finance systems.
- Variance (%): Calculated as ((Actual - Budget) / Budget) × 100.
- Efficiency Trend: Flagged based on performance drift over time.
Formulas Required
The template leverages Excel’s power functions for dynamic analysis:
- =VLOOKUP(): To cross-reference workflow IDs with resource data.
- =IF() / =AND(): For conditional flags such as “Over Budget” or “Efficiency Below Threshold”.
- =SUMIFS(): Aggregates budget by department, category, or time period.
- =AVERAGEIFS(): Calculates average process times across similar workflows.
- =ROUND(…, 2): Ensures currency values display with two decimal places.
- =DATEDIF(): Measures duration differences between start and end dates.
Conditional Formatting Rules
To enhance readability and alert users to anomalies, the following rules are applied:
- Red Highlight: When variance exceeds +15% or -10% (underperformance or overspending).
- Yellow Highlight: For variances between ±5%—warning signs of potential drift.
- Green Highlight: When efficiency score is above 90%, indicating optimal workflow performance.
- Color Scales: Applied to process duration and cost columns to visualize efficiency trends across workflows.
User Instructions
To use this template effectively:
- Open the workbook and begin by populating the "Workflows & Process Mapping" sheet with current processes and owners.
- Enter initial budget values in the "Budget Allocation by Workflow" sheet. Ensure all categories align with your organization’s cost structure.
- For each workflow, input actual process times and costs during monthly reviews in the "Actual vs. Budget Performance" sheet.
- Use the Data Summary Dashboard to generate quick insights—this is updated automatically when new data is entered.
- Review efficiency scores every quarter to identify bottlenecks or underperforming processes.
- Adjust budgets based on performance trends and real-world workflow changes in the next fiscal cycle.
